WebSilage is made of forages, crop residues, or agricultural or industrial by-products that have been preserved by natural or artificial acidification, for use as animal feed in periods when feed supply is inadequate. Ensilation, being a natural process, was already used by farmers in ancient times. Each acronym stands for the … WebMar 6, 2024 · 1. Allow the swaths to wilt down for about half a day before harvesting. The forage will need to be dried down to about 60 to 70% moisture before chopping for silage. Silage can be put up at higher moisture, but as mentioned above seepage will be an issue.
